Abstract
In the quasi-Abelian approximation as well as in the large- limit sources in the adjoint representation cannot be screened. Nevertheless, the two phenomena are different because the string tension is proportional to the square root of the Casimir operator in the first case and to the Casimir operator itself in the second.
